Modifying Numbering in an Ordered List

You can remove the numbering from a paragraph in an ordered list or change the number that an ordered list starts with.

To Remove the Number From a Paragraph in an Ordered List

Click in front of the first character of the paragraph that you want to remove the numbering from. Do one of the following: To remove the number while preserving the indent of the paragraph, press the Backspace key. To remove the number and the indent of the paragraph, click the No List icon on the Formatting Bar. If you save the document in HTML format, a separate numbered list is created for the numbered paragraphs that follow the current paragraph.

To Change the Number That an Ordered List Starts With

Click anywhere in the ordered list. Choose Format - Bullets and Numbering, and then click the Customize tab. Enter the number you want the list to start with in the Start at box. Click OK.
